如何在.NET2.0(c#/vb.NET)中从其他服务器播放mp3文件?

如何在.NET2.0(c#/vb.NET)中从其他服务器播放mp3文件?,c#,streaming,mp3,audio-streaming,C#,Streaming,Mp3,Audio Streaming,我想创建一个窗口应用程序,它将播放mp3文件,这将在不同的服务器上 比如, 我有一个URL()。我想从本地计算机上的Windows应用程序播放此文件,而不下载此文件。(借助流媒体) 我有使用“winmm.dll”并播放本地mp3文件的代码。有没有一种方法,我可以使用这个dll来播放这种文件 您也可以向我推荐任何其他方法。查看一下最简单的方法是使用(隐藏模式)。 它可以处理http URL和本地(文件)URL 如何:我尝试过这种方法,但不起作用。我已使用Windows Media Player控件

我想创建一个窗口应用程序,它将播放mp3文件,这将在不同的服务器上

比如,

我有一个URL()。我想从本地计算机上的Windows应用程序播放此文件,而不下载此文件。(借助流媒体)

我有使用“winmm.dll”并播放本地mp3文件的代码。有没有一种方法,我可以使用这个dll来播放这种文件


您也可以向我推荐任何其他方法。

查看一下最简单的方法是使用(隐藏模式)。
它可以处理http URL和本地(文件)URL


如何:

我尝试过这种方法,但不起作用。我已使用Windows Media Player控件并将其URL属性设置为“”。但如果我点击播放按钮,它就不会播放那个文件。预期的行为应该是开始缓冲该mp3文件。我是否缺少设置播放器控件的某些属性?我收到一个错误,上面写着“C00D1197:无法播放文件”是的,它对我有效。我设置的URL不正确。您提供的链接没有指向MP3文件,而是指向具有指向这些文件的链接的web